Creamy Tortellini & Chicken Divan Bake
- Total Time: 1 hour
- Yield: 7 1x
Description
Creamy tortellini and chicken divan bake combines classic comfort with Italian-inspired elegance. Home chefs can enjoy this hearty casserole that delivers rich flavors and satisfying textures you’ll crave again and again.
Ingredients
- 4 cups chopped cooked chicken
- 1 (20 oz / 567 g) package refrigerated cheese-and-spinach tortellini
- 3 cups chicken broth
- 1 ½ cups half-and-half
- 4 cups chopped fresh broccoli
- ½ cup butter
- 1 cup (4 oz / 113 g) freshly shredded Parmesan cheese
- 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
- ½ cup dry white wine
- ½ cup chopped sweet onion
- ½ cup chopped red bell pepper
- ½ cup chopped pecans
- 3 tbsps butter, melted
- ¼ cup all-purpose flour
- 15 round buttery crackers, crushed
- 2 garlic cloves, minced
- ¼ tsp table salt
- ¼ tsp ground red pepper
Instructions
- Preparation: Preheat oven to 350°F with rack centered for even heat distribution.
- Sauce Foundation: In a Dutch oven, melt butter and sauté onions, red bell peppers, and garlic until vegetables become translucent and fragrant, releasing their essential aromatics.
- Roux Development: Sprinkle flour over the vegetable mixture, stirring thoroughly to eliminate raw flour taste and create a smooth base for the sauce.
- Liquid Integration: Gradually whisk in chicken broth, half-and-half, and white wine, creating a silky, lump-free sauce that develops rich complexity.
- Sauce Refinement: Simmer until thickened, then remove from heat and incorporate Parmesan cheese and ground red pepper, adding depth and subtle warmth.
- Ingredient Harmony: Fold tortellini, broccoli florets, and chicken into the sauce, ensuring complete coating and flavor integration.
- Casserole Assembly: Transfer the mixture to a greased 13×9-inch baking dish, spreading evenly to create a consistent layer.
- Crispy Topping: Combine Parmesan cheese, crushed crackers, chopped pecans, and melted butter to create a crunchy, golden-brown crown for the casserole.
- Baking Process: Bake for 40-45 minutes until the top turns golden and edges bubble, signaling perfect doneness and flavor melding.
- Serving Preparation: Allow the casserole to rest briefly after removing from oven, enabling flavors to settle and sauce to stabilize before serving.
Notes
- Prep Sauce Strategically: Develop a smooth, lump-free sauce by whisking constantly and adding liquids gradually to prevent separation.
- Enhance Flavor Depth: Toast flour briefly in the vegetable mixture to eliminate raw taste and build a rich, complex foundation for the dish.
- Prevent Overcooking Vegetables: Add broccoli florets carefully to maintain their bright color and crisp texture during the final baking process.
- Cracker Topping Tip: Crush crackers to medium-fine consistency for the perfect balance between crunch and even coverage on the casserole surface.
